The vision in Daniel Chapter 9 was given to Daniel during the same time period of Chapter 6. Daniel pleaded with God to bring about the promised return of his people to their land. The prophet Jeremiah has written that God would not allow the captives to return to their land for 70 years. Daniel knew of this prophecy and realized that the 70-year period was coming to an end, having understood the merciful and forgiving character of God, he prayed for the nation confessing his own sin using the pronoun we throughout. In times of adversity, it’s easy to blame others and excuse our own actions. If any Israelite was righteous, it was Daniel, and yet he confessed his sinfulness and need for God’s forgiveness. The captives from Judah had rebelled against God. Their sins had led to their captivity. But God is merciful even to rebels if they confess their sins and return to him.
